NAME
regulator_has_full_constraints - the system has fully specified constraints
SYNOPSIS
void regulator_has_full_constraints(void);
ARGUMENTS
void no arguments
DESCRIPTION
Calling this function will cause the regulator API to disable all regulators which have a zero use count and don't have an always_on constraint in a late_initcall. The intention is that this will become the default behaviour in a future kernel release so users are encouraged to use this facility now.
